In this inspiring episode of Being Jewish with Jonah Platt: 30 Minute Mensches, Jonah sits down with acclaimed Disney animator, filmmaker, and motivational speaker Saul Blinkoff for a powerful conversation about Jewish resilience, Disney magic, and living a life of purpose. Together, they explore how timeless Jewish values are embedded in iconic animated films like The Lion King, and Saul speaks passionately about finding meaning in your Jewish identity every day, and the importance of living with responsibility and intention.
Saul reflects on his transformative trips to Israel as a guide with the nonprofit Momentum, and urges Jews worldwide to "LIVE FOR the Jewish people" as Israeli sons and daughters die to defend them. He and Jonah discuss how Jewish resilience, hope, and creativity can be antidotes to despair, even in the face of the horrors of October 7th. They also tackle:
- ⁇ Was Walt Disney really an antisemite?
- 🎬 The hidden Jewish values in your favorite Disney films
- 🇮🇱 Why Saul insists it’s safe (and necessary) to go to Israel right NOW
- 🌟 The miraculous story of Omer Shem Tov, who kept his hope and Jewish identity alive, even as a Hamas hostage in Gaza
